Common Name: white oak
Scientific Name: Quercus alba
Category: Historic tree
Comments: This tree, located on the parade grounds at Fort Monroe, was planted in soil brought to the U.S. from Normandy, France. The tree was planted on the 40th anniversary of the Normandy Invasion, June 6, 1944, by Col. Richard Machin, Post Commander, and Col. Jean Burel, French Liaison Officer.
